    Walmart Super-center is a massive one stop shopping center for commoners. They have grocery, pharmacy, apparel, vision center, McDonalds, electronics, garden stuff etc. Every corner of Murica has them. This location is at the city of Rosemead. It's my first time at Walmart. I was astonished how massive it was and shelves were fully stocked. Similarly, their prices seem lower than most grocery shopping centers. I came here to check if they have the four items that I need. And they do! Staff were cordial and competent. Checkout counter was easy. Parking lot was huge and easy to find a spot. Overall, I had a smooth experience and I recommend this center.

    I've used Walmart's online pickup many times before and never had an issue, but this location has no control over its online department. There were 30+ cars waiting, no communication, and I waited over two hours with no explanation, despite Walmart advertising this service as fast and efficient. It was obvious no one cared. Employees were checking headphones, texting, or answering calls while on the job, moving as slowly as possible. The pickup entrance was blocked, and the entire fire lane was cluttered with equipment and items. If there were an emergency or fire, it would be a complete catastrophe trying to get people out. The store eventually closed, orders stopped coming out, and I was told, "We closed at 10." I had to return another day only to learn most of my order was put back, and when I requested a cancellation, a manager snickered and made a rude comment. If they're this overwhelmed, they should stop accepting online orders for the day and catch up -- but nothing was done. When I left, 20-30 cars were still waiting without groceries, affecting families, kids, and elderly customers. This is terrible management, poor judgment, and total disregard for customers. Avoid online pickup at this location.
